One great example is”Leadboxes” — essentially beautifully designed pop-ups that will enable you to hit your mark, without being bothersome. You can also go for an option to track your visitor’s interactions with your pop-up, letting you see and access data that can allow you to ascertain its effectiveness.

Coupled with Google Analytics, this could enable you to see exactly what works and what doesn’t so that you can evaluate your next steps.

They also permit you to make your own alert bars — small bars found at the top of your browser display that usually alerts you to a purchase or even a promo. Besides being a helpful addition, Leadpages has made it so it’s simple to design!

And of course, there are Leadlinks — Links you can embed in an email so that each of the recipients must do is click once and they’ll automatically opt-in. Having an easy sign up option is always a fantastic answer to people’s dislike for complicated or time consuming sign-up processes.

A good thing that Leadpages did not overlook was appropriate integration. They took the lead with that and it’s insanely useful.

It’s possible to join your Leadpages with pretty much any email, payment processor, social media app, analytics program and much more. Google analytics, Facebook Advertising and over 40+ other options — in a universe where connectivity and data imply a lot, being this incorporated is a huge, enormous boon for you.

Lead By Price

Leadpages is not cheap, but that is not to say it isn’t worth it. It’s worth far more than the price you pay, .

The conventional strategy of Leadpages is $37 a month. It can go down to $25 or even $17 per month if you opt for the 1-year or 2-year plan, respectively. Leadpages With Popup Email Collector

If you want to become serious about it, and come armed with AB testing, Leaddigits, and Leadlinks, then the Pro Plan will cost you around $79 a month. Much like the normal plan, if you commit to a more comprehensive strategy, you can get it at either $49 per month or $24 a month to get a 1-year or 2-year commitment, respectively.

And finally there is the Advanced Plan Lead pages, which they recommend for marketing teams and agencies. This is the plan where they pull out all the big guns and offer you pretty much everything. Here, you can purchase it for $159 a month for a 2-year lock in, or at $199 a month for an annual plan.

There isn’t a monthly price option for Advanced though, so take note.

Adding it all together, you’re going to be committing about $300 for a 1-year subscription deal Which could be little hefty, yes. But then again, for all you’re getting, it’s a pretty good deal. It will never be regarded as a steal, but you can say value for money for sure.

And for what it is worth, they offer a 14-day trial as well as a 30-day Money-Back Guarantee. So in case it is not for you, it is simple enough to rectify that decision.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S Leadpages With Popup Email Collector

Q: Can I connect whatever I construct using Leadpages to my domainname?

A: Yes! Each page published with Leadpages is hosted on our servers at your Leadpages domainname. If you already have domain, it’s really easy to connect your domain name to your leadpages accounts and publish it into the domain of your choosing.

Q: Does Leadpages come with a free trial, or do I have to purchase it to use it?

A: Leadpages gives out a 14-day free trial for you to test out so you can see what they have to offer!

Q: When I use the Free Trial, will the version of Leadpages I’ll be utilizing be restricted?

A: No, you’ll receive free, unlimited access to a chosen Leadpages plan. You can use it as though you were a paying customer for 14-days, no strings attached. Once the 14 days are up, you’ll automatically become a paid subscriber, so be sure to cancel before that, in case you’re not convinced you need Leadpages in your life .

Q: Could Leadpages replace my site?

A: Yes. It can act as a supplement to your existing site, or replace it altogether in the event that you’d like it to. With Leadpages‘s simple to use tools, it is definitely within your reach.
